The Vikings are likely to play another game without receiver Percy Harvin.  Harvin missed practice Friday with a sprained left ankle and is listed as "doubtful" for Sunday's game at Green Bay against the Packers.  Tight end Kyle Rudolph and safety Harrison Smith both fully practiced for the Vikings Friday and both are expected to play despite concussion suffered against Chicago last week.

Running back Adrian Peterson is also listed as probable with a shoulder injury for Minnesota.  The Vikings are 6-5 while Green Bay is 7-4.  Minnesota is a 10-point underdog.  Kickoff Sunday at noon, pregame on WJON at 11am.
